    What is wEMBOSS?

    A web interface to the EMBOSS packagefor sequence analysis

    Its developed by Martin Sarachu (Argentina)and Marc Colet (Belgium)

    wEMBOSS program: wossname

    Easy to forget a program name

    To find programs, use wossname

    wossname finds programs by looking for keywords in thedescription or the name of the program

    Pairvise alignment - Dotup

    One sequence is represented on each axis and significantmatching regions are distributed along diagonals in the matrix.

    Multiple alignment -prettyplot

    Identical residues are shown in red, and similar residues ingreen

    This type of display can give you a first impression of regions ofconservation.
